Equipment Structure
The unit adopts a combined side and top air duct circulation system. It features double doors with flush-mounted concealed latches and is sealed with high-temperature silicone rubber strips. Four swivel casters are installed at the base for mobility.
Interior Material
Constructed from 304 stainless steel using argon arc full welding to ensure excellent airtightness.
Air Duct Material
Made of 304 stainless steel, fixed by sheet metal bending and forming.
Exterior Material
The exterior utilizes 1.2mm thick cold-rolled carbon steel plate. It undergoes anti-rust treatment followed by electrostatic spraying for scratch resistance.
Reinforcement Frame
Built with 5# and 4# angle iron, partially reinforced with channel-type sheet metal welding for structural integrity.
Insulation Material
Filled with 120K grade high-density aluminum silicate fiber. The insulation layer thickness is 100mm.
Side Exhaust Port
Diameter: 120mm, designed to connect to external piping.
Control Box
Features a side-mounted control box installed on the left side of the machine.
Temperature Control Method
Utilizes a PT100 platinum resistance sensor for signal input, with an accuracy of ±0.5%.
Temperature Control Device
Employs a P.I.D intelligent temperature control instrument featuring LED digital display and setting, P.I.D automatic calculation, and timer functions.
Temperature Control Output
SSR (Solid State Relay) output.
Heating Method
Adopts far-infrared 304 stainless steel "W" type heating tubes, designed for a continuous service life exceeding 60,000 hours.
Circulation Motor
Equipped with two 1100W long-shaft oven motors paired with multi-blade centrifugal fans. Motors feature vibration-proof design and self-cooling. (Wind speed is adjustable).
Safety Protection Measures
Includes leakage circuit breakers, over-temperature protection, phase failure protection, motor overload current protection, and an audible buzzer alarm for machine abnormalities.
